Product reviews:
Lionel
2025-12-23 iphone 11 Pro
The Latest Dr Leonard's Catalog is Here dr leonard catalog shopping
dr leonard catalog shopping
Tyler
2025-12-17 iphone 6s Plus
Dr. Leonard's - Home | Facebook dr leonard catalog shopping
dr leonard catalog shopping
Sid
2025-12-18 iphone 7 Plus
Discount Health Products from Dr dr leonard catalog shopping
dr leonard catalog shopping